SEE HANDOUTS FOR DETAILSNRE 7014Integrative research seminar•Produce a jointly authored document.–Can be collection of manuscripts. –Often published.•Examination of literature, theory and thought.•Can include data collection, case studies, interviews, document analysis, etc.•Meets 3+ hours/week through fall and winter. •Defined by faculty or established by students.•Needs a faculty advisor. Does not need a client.NRE 7015Final project deliverables•The “black book” is required.•Additional documents are usually needed:–Presentation at professional and/or academic conferences (e.g., poster, paper, workshop).–Article in professional magazine and peer-reviewed journals.–Presentation to client and their community.–Technical report for dissemination by client.–Webpage release of findings.–Brochure, summary report, press-release, etc.NRE 7016A posterNRE 7017Book, journal article, newsletter, product design …Check webpage for more.www.snre.umich.edu/nre701QUESTIONS
